Discussion: We needed to take out the baulk created by digging out the grave (2416) because there were walls running through and underneath it. We separated it into three units, as there was a plaster line (16808) and a wall (16830) on the southern side. There were a few finds in the fill, mostly bone and pottery (approx 5% for both), and one piece of obsidian.
